How much does a Charge Nurse make in Bradenton, FL?
Charge Nurses in Bradenton, FL, enjoy a rewarding career with a competitive salary. On average, a Charge Nurse earns about $80,783 per year. This figure reflects the dedication and skill required for the role. The salary range can vary, with many Charge Nurses earning between $65,300 and $94,800 annually. This range depends on factors such as experience, education, and the specific healthcare facility.
The salary data shows that Charge Nurses in Bradenton have a good earning potential. The lower end of the range, around $65,300, is typical for those just starting in the role. As Charge Nurses gain more experience, their salaries can increase significantly. The higher end of the range, around $94,800, is often seen in those with advanced degrees or additional certifications. This range provides a clear path for career growth and financial stability.
